## Deployment: Watchdog (Orchardpost Kiosk)

The Orchardpost kiosk ships with a watchdog process that restarts the shell if it hangs or a plugin crashes the render loop. Plugin authors should note that the watchdog treats repeated crashes within a short window as a fault and quarantines the offending plugin. Heartbeat intervals and restart backoff are tunable per fleet. Test against the defaults before shipping. The watchdog starts with the following configuration.

deployment values, yafog-tahop:
ZOROK_PIN=9451
ZOROK_TENANT=novael
ZOROK_METRICS_HOST=metrics.zorok.crelvocloud.corp
ZOROK_SEAL=seal_8d0b0d39
ZOROK_STANDBY_TEAM=jorir

Action item from the Brindlewick kiosk outage: the watchdog on the Ordertide app was way too trigger-happy, restarting the UI mid-transaction whenever the scanner lagged. Marisol's fix loosens the restart thresholds and adds a grace window after boot. Please verify the new constants land in the 4.2 release build. The tuned values are as follows.

limits module of yadug-yagap:
RATE_LIMITS = {
    "quenix": 5,
    "druwyn": 2,
}

Before shipping plugins against the Copperline internal gateway, confirm your plugin honors the new per-tenant rate limits. Burst allowance dropped from 200 to 120 requests per ten-second window, and 429 responses now include a retry-after header your plugin must respect. Plugins that hammer the gateway after a 429 will be quarantined automatically. Test against the staging gateway, which mirrors production limits exactly. For support escalations, quote the gateway build shown directly below.

trace token, fafog-kageg: htk4_98e6